अयनांश — Multi-Ayanāṁśa Comparison

Different Vedic schools use different ayanāṁśa anchors. For cuspal placements (planets near sign-boundaries), the ayanāṁśa choice determines which sign the planet falls in.

SystemAnchorValue
Lahiri ChitrāpakṣaJ2000.0 (Indian official)24.0244°
SS-Native CitrāBhāskara II uniform precession (285 CE)24.1344°
RamanB.V. Raman zero-point22.1647°

SS-native is Bhāskara-II uniform precession anchored at Citrā-zero (285 CE). Lahiri uses J2000 reference. Raman uses later zero-point.
